مشاركة عبر


PrestoLinkedService interface

خدمة مرتبطة بخادم Presto. هذه الخدمة المرتبطة لديها خاصية إصدار مدعومة. تمت جدولة الإصدار 1.0 للإهمال بينما سيستمر خط الأنابيب الخاص بك في العمل بعد موسوعة الحياة ولكن دون أي إصلاح للأخطاء أو ميزات جديدة.

يمتد

الخصائص

allowHostNameCNMismatch

يحدد ما إذا كان يجب طلب اسم شهادة SSL صادر عن CA لمطابقة اسم مضيف الخادم عند الاتصال عبر SSL. القيمة الافتراضية خاطئة. يستخدم فقط للإصدار 1.0.

allowSelfSignedServerCert

تحديد ما إذا كان يجب السماح بالشهادات الموقعة ذاتيا من الخادم. القيمة الافتراضية خاطئة. يستخدم فقط للإصدار 1.0.

authenticationType

آلية المصادقة المستخدمة للاتصال بخادم Presto.

catalog

سياق الكتالوج لكافة الطلبات مقابل الخادم.

enableServerCertificateValidation

يحدد ما إذا كانت الاتصالات بالخادم ستتحقق من صحة شهادة الخادم، القيمة الافتراضية هي True. يستخدم فقط للإصدار 2.0

enableSsl

تحديد ما إذا كانت الاتصالات بالخادم مشفرة باستخدام SSL. القيمة الافتراضية للإصدار القديم هي False. القيمة الافتراضية للإصدار 2.0 هي True.

encryptedCredential

بيانات الاعتماد المشفرة المستخدمة للمصادقة. يتم تشفير بيانات الاعتماد باستخدام مدير بيانات اعتماد وقت تشغيل التكامل. النوع: سلسلة (أو تعبير مع سلسلة resultType).

host

عنوان IP أو اسم المضيف لخادم Presto. (أي 192.168.222.160)

password

كلمة المرور المطابقة لاسم المستخدم.

port

منفذ TCP الذي يستخدمه خادم Presto للاستماع إلى اتصالات العميل. القيمة الافتراضية هي 8080 عند تعطيل SSL، القيمة الافتراضية هي 443 عند تمكين SSL.

serverVersion

إصدار خادم Presto. (أي 0.148-t) يستخدم فقط للإصدار 1.0.

timeZoneID

المنطقة الزمنية المحلية المستخدمة من قبل الاتصال. يتم تحديد القيم الصالحة لهذا الخيار في قاعدة بيانات المنطقة الزمنية IANA. القيمة الافتراضية للإصدار 1.0 هي المنطقة الزمنية لنظام العميل. القيمة الافتراضية للإصدار 2.0 هي المنطقة الزمنية لنظام الخادم

trustedCertPath

المسار الكامل لملف .pem الذي يحتوي على شهادات CA موثوق بها للتحقق من الخادم عند الاتصال عبر SSL. يمكن تعيين هذه الخاصية فقط عند استخدام SSL على وقت تشغيل التكامل المستضاف ذاتيا. القيمة الافتراضية هي ملف cacerts.pem المثبت مع وقت تشغيل التكامل. يستخدم فقط للإصدار 1.0.

type

تمييزي متعدد الأشكال، والذي يحدد الأنواع المختلفة التي يمكن أن يكون هذا الكائن

username

اسم المستخدم المستخدم للاتصال بخادم Presto.

useSystemTrustStore

تحديد ما إذا كان يجب استخدام شهادة CA من مخزن ثقة النظام أو من ملف PEM محدد. القيمة الافتراضية خاطئة. يستخدم فقط للإصدار 1.0.

الخصائص الموروثة

annotations

قائمة العلامات التي يمكن استخدامها لوصف الخدمة المرتبطة.

connectVia

مرجع وقت تشغيل التكامل.

description

وصف الخدمة المرتبطة.

parameters

معلمات الخدمة المرتبطة.

version

إصدار الخدمة المرتبطة.

تفاصيل الخاصية

allowHostNameCNMismatch

يحدد ما إذا كان يجب طلب اسم شهادة SSL صادر عن CA لمطابقة اسم مضيف الخادم عند الاتصال عبر SSL. القيمة الافتراضية خاطئة. يستخدم فقط للإصدار 1.0.

allowHostNameCNMismatch?: any

قيمة الخاصية

any

allowSelfSignedServerCert

تحديد ما إذا كان يجب السماح بالشهادات الموقعة ذاتيا من الخادم. القيمة الافتراضية خاطئة. يستخدم فقط للإصدار 1.0.

allowSelfSignedServerCert?: any

قيمة الخاصية

any

authenticationType

آلية المصادقة المستخدمة للاتصال بخادم Presto.

authenticationType: string

قيمة الخاصية

string

catalog

سياق الكتالوج لكافة الطلبات مقابل الخادم.

catalog: any

قيمة الخاصية

any

enableServerCertificateValidation

يحدد ما إذا كانت الاتصالات بالخادم ستتحقق من صحة شهادة الخادم، القيمة الافتراضية هي True. يستخدم فقط للإصدار 2.0

enableServerCertificateValidation?: any

قيمة الخاصية

any

enableSsl

تحديد ما إذا كانت الاتصالات بالخادم مشفرة باستخدام SSL. القيمة الافتراضية للإصدار القديم هي False. القيمة الافتراضية للإصدار 2.0 هي True.

enableSsl?: any

قيمة الخاصية

any

encryptedCredential

بيانات الاعتماد المشفرة المستخدمة للمصادقة. يتم تشفير بيانات الاعتماد باستخدام مدير بيانات اعتماد وقت تشغيل التكامل. النوع: سلسلة (أو تعبير مع سلسلة resultType).

encryptedCredential?: any

قيمة الخاصية

any

host

عنوان IP أو اسم المضيف لخادم Presto. (أي 192.168.222.160)

host: any

قيمة الخاصية

any

password

كلمة المرور المطابقة لاسم المستخدم.

password?: SecretBaseUnion

قيمة الخاصية

port

منفذ TCP الذي يستخدمه خادم Presto للاستماع إلى اتصالات العميل. القيمة الافتراضية هي 8080 عند تعطيل SSL، القيمة الافتراضية هي 443 عند تمكين SSL.

port?: any

قيمة الخاصية

any

serverVersion

إصدار خادم Presto. (أي 0.148-t) يستخدم فقط للإصدار 1.0.

serverVersion?: any

قيمة الخاصية

any

timeZoneID

المنطقة الزمنية المحلية المستخدمة من قبل الاتصال. يتم تحديد القيم الصالحة لهذا الخيار في قاعدة بيانات المنطقة الزمنية IANA. القيمة الافتراضية للإصدار 1.0 هي المنطقة الزمنية لنظام العميل. القيمة الافتراضية للإصدار 2.0 هي المنطقة الزمنية لنظام الخادم

timeZoneID?: any

قيمة الخاصية

any

trustedCertPath

المسار الكامل لملف .pem الذي يحتوي على شهادات CA موثوق بها للتحقق من الخادم عند الاتصال عبر SSL. يمكن تعيين هذه الخاصية فقط عند استخدام SSL على وقت تشغيل التكامل المستضاف ذاتيا. القيمة الافتراضية هي ملف cacerts.pem المثبت مع وقت تشغيل التكامل. يستخدم فقط للإصدار 1.0.

trustedCertPath?: any

قيمة الخاصية

any

type

تمييزي متعدد الأشكال، والذي يحدد الأنواع المختلفة التي يمكن أن يكون هذا الكائن

type: "Presto"

قيمة الخاصية

"Presto"

username

اسم المستخدم المستخدم للاتصال بخادم Presto.

username?: any

قيمة الخاصية

any

useSystemTrustStore

تحديد ما إذا كان يجب استخدام شهادة CA من مخزن ثقة النظام أو من ملف PEM محدد. القيمة الافتراضية خاطئة. يستخدم فقط للإصدار 1.0.

useSystemTrustStore?: any

قيمة الخاصية

any

تفاصيل الخاصية الموروثة

annotations

قائمة العلامات التي يمكن استخدامها لوصف الخدمة المرتبطة.

annotations?: any[]

قيمة الخاصية

any[]

موروثة منLinkedService.annotations

connectVia

مرجع وقت تشغيل التكامل.

connectVia?: IntegrationRuntimeReference

قيمة الخاصية

موروث منLinkedService.connectVia

description

وصف الخدمة المرتبطة.

description?: string

قيمة الخاصية

string

موروث منLinkedService.description

parameters

معلمات الخدمة المرتبطة.

parameters?: {[propertyName: string]: ParameterSpecification}

قيمة الخاصية

{[propertyName: string]: ParameterSpecification}

موروثة منLinkedService.parameters

version

إصدار الخدمة المرتبطة.

version?: string

قيمة الخاصية

string

موروث منLinkedService.version